ephemeris.jyds doesn't seem to reload after zooming in, so that resolution is poor
Regarding the ephemeris.jyds script which loads data for the time axis, I can see that there's a bug in how I'm loading it. The script identifies a cadence to use when loading the data so that the das2server isn't overloaded. If you are looking at a 100-day plot, it loads ephemeris at a courser resolution than if you are looking at a 1 minute plot, for example. The problem is I'm not sure the script is re-run if you zoom in. So, if you see this behavior, please work-around this for now by manually forcing a reload of the data with ctrl-L. I'm not sure if there was no way to properly handle this when I wrote the script, or if I just didn't think of it. I'll look into this soon.
